All SMD and through-hole components placed on the same side of the PCB.
This is not a step backward. It is cost optimization.
| Comparison |
Double-Side PCBA |
Single-Side PCBA (Same Side) |
| Pick-and-Place Runs |
2 (top and bottom) |
1 |
| Reflow Soldering Passes |
2 |
1 |
| Wave Soldering / Touch-Up |
Complex (bottom side components need protection) |
Simple (one pass for all) |
| Component Drop-Off Risk |
Yes (components on bottom side may fall during second reflow) |
None |
| Carrier Fixtures |
Required (trays / pallets) |
Not required or very simple |
| Panelization Efficiency |
Limited by double-side layout |
Highly flexible, high utilization |
| Bulk Unit Price |
Baseline |
15-30% lower |
